Abstract

Abstract This study aims to describe the improvement in Civic Disposition of Primary School Students through the application of the Value Clarivication Technique Model. This research is a classroom action research using descriptive qualitative methods. Data were collected through observation, documentation and daily notes. The data collected were analyzed using descriptive statistics. Increased civic disposition can be seen from the results of observations of the first cycle which shows as many as 6 indicators out of all 8 indicators that met the success criteria. In cycle II, all indicators measured increased and > 60% or in accordance with expected indicators of research success. It can be concluded that the application of the Value Clarivication Technique model can improve students' civic Disposition.
